A Future Ready Grid

Building long-distance transmission infrastructure and distribution networks are fundamental to improving grid reliability, capacity and connecting renewable energy to demand centers.

Low Carbon Communities

Advancing electrification is a catalyst to lower emissions across transportation networks and buildings to achieve a more resilient future in places where we live, work and play.

Renewable Generation

Harnessing the power of low carbon energy sources such as wind, solar, hydrogen, bioenergy and hydropower to advance new energy resources while protecting the environment.

EV Fires Demand Rethinking How Transit Facilities Are Designed

As public transit agencies transition to battery electric buses, WSP is helping to design safe bus depots and parking facilities prepared to handle the unique fire hazard of electric vehicles.
